Everyone needs to realize that this beautiful ship was one of only 3 U.S. battleships to serve as naval gunfire support at Normandy and one of only 2 battleships to serve at OMAHA BEACH on D-Day!!! She served as the naval gunfire flagship of the whole Omaha Beach fleet during June 1944. She supported Operation Torch in North Africa, D-Day and Dragoon in South France, Iwo Jima, and Okinawa!

My uncle was the Texas Executive Officer at the end of WWII and for a few months afterwards. He told me he is most proud of is not one Texas sailor was badly injured or died from accidents during his tour of duty. After the war ended, the USS Texas was in Sasebo Naval Base. A rare jeep was assigned to the USS Texas. My uncle and the CO drove to Nagasaki to view the damage from the nuclear bomb.

I've often wondered about the Ship's original armaments, in that it listed 21 5"/51'ers. I finally figured why it was an odd number. I saw a 1918 photo that showed that the ship had a 5"/51 "tail gun" in a sponson in line with the rest of the lower sponsons. Five, including the "tail gun" were removed in 1926, and another ten in 1942.
